Invited member of the 15-person NEON National Network Design Committee (NNDC). The NNDC is responsible for drafting the Integrated Science and Education Plan, the Networking and Informatics Baseline Design, and the Project Execution Plan (PEP) for NEON. These reports will be given to the National Science Foundation and the U.S. Congress for a funding decision in late 2006. Also an invited member of the 10-person Land Use Subcommittee of the NEON Science and Human Dimensions Committee. * Determining the degree to which the existing network of AmeriFlux carbon eddy-flux towers are representative of flux environments across the conterminous U.S. Can be used to determine how many additional towers will be required, and where additional towers should be placed. The importance and uniqueness of each existing tower to the AmeriFlux network will also be calculated. Office of Biological and Ecological Research, DOE. * Developing a practical Map-Analysis Tool to predict corridors used by wildlife and plants as they disperse from one patch to another. Tracks large numbers of synthetic "walkers" which are imbued with the preference and dispersal characteristics of particular species as they travel over landscapes. Produces maps of potential dispersal corridors, a patch-to-patch transfer matrix, and a map of patch importance values for each map category desired. San Diego, CA - 2006. * Developed Mapcurves, a quantitative, region-based map comparison tool. Produces the best translation table between categories in each map, based on spatial overlay, as an output product rather than requiring a translation table as an input. Capable of comparing two or more maps, this tool makes it possible to compare alternative ecoregion schemes, even if they contain different numbers of ecoregions. Maps are being used to prioritize ecological preservation and restoration - 2005. * Developed a new climate change impact analysis method, Minimum Required Migration Distances (MRM). Determines how far a species or community would have to move in order to return to the combination of conditions they had prior to a climatic change.
